Can't instal Toorgle Firefox search bar it says:- You will need a browser which supports Sherlock to install this plugin

The website is trying to add a search engine using a severely dated method that was dropped in Firefox 44. See Adding search engines from web pages for more information.

Unfortunately, if you are not the website owner or administrator, there is nothing you can do about this issue.

To the best of my knowledge, Sherlock plugins were dropped in Firefox 44 in favour of OpenSearch plugins, which have been around nearly as long as Sherlock plugins.

Unfortunately, the developer of that website is using a Sherlock version, not OpenSearch. You'll have to reach out to the website administrator to have them update that feature.

Sadly it does not.

"Stop supporting installation of Sherlock plugins from the web. Search provider add-ons should be implemented using OpenSearch." According to Add-on Compatibility for Firefox 44 (Dec 29, 2015).

You can also refer to bug 862148 for more information.
